/******************************************************
* @test validate the equality and order relations of
* Asset::Ident and Asset objects.
* @note a known problem is that only Asset smart ptrs
* are supported for comparison, not smartpointers
* of Asset subclasses. To solve this, we would
* either have to repeat the operator definitions,
* or resort to template metaprogramming tricks.
* Just providing templated comparison operators
* would generally override the behaviour of
* std::shared_ptr, which is not desirable.
* @see Asset::Ident#compare
*/
